A leading national house builder are looking to recruit a Development Engineer to work from their Ipswich office.

The role

Based within the Technical Department, the role will be to provide engineering design and maintain technical support to all regional departments and site based teams to enable the region to achieve its objectives and agreed goals.

Duties:

  • Provide Engineering support and technical guidance for regional site and office based operations.
  • Provide Engineering Support in respect of planning applications.
  • Provide Engineering Information for land viability purposes.
  • Instructing, supervising and monitoring engineering consultants for various surveys and structural /civil engineering designs as required.
  • Ensuring compliance with Building Regulations and Statutory Authorities.
  • Provide support in relation to demolition, site clearance, road and sewer infrastructure works, utilities, external works and other construction related matters on a variety of residential housing developments.

Engineering and Design

  • Assistance in the preparation of Land Appraisal Viabilities
  • Interpret Geotechnical and Environmental Reports
  • Prepare design solutions for initial road and sewer infrastructure
  • Satisfactory resolve engineering issues as part of planning application
  • Finalise plot floor levels and ensure efficiencies of external level designs.
  • Co-ordinate and manage external consultants to resolve engineering issues in order to allow planning consents to be issued
  • Interact closely with design and planning team to deliver planning consents
  • Manage consultants in the preparation of infrastructure, foundation, plot drainage and external level designs
  • Monitor and resolve any Building Regulation/CML issues
  • Manage and co-ordinate remediation strategies and ensure regulatory approvals are obtained
  • Ensure all information is available for Pre-Start Meetings
  • Ensure all engineering drawings for start on site including infrastructure, foundations and any remediation proposals
  • Secure necessary technical approval for roads and sewers designs
  • Provide all utility drawings of existing, proposed and diversions including obtaining competitive quotations from utility providers. Procurement and co-ordination of off-site service reinforcement, diversions, substations, gas governors plot connections etc and ensure all legal agreements are completed.
  • Obtain street lighting designs and procure new postal addresses and agreeing street name plate specifications and locations.
  • Produce designs in agreed timescales to ensure regional targets are achieved.
  • Understand the commercial aspects of design decisions.
  • Liaise with Local Authority Building Control to resolve technical and design issues.
  • Attend Project Team, Health and Safety, Site and any other relevant meetings as required.
  • Must be able to communicate well with all departments and levels.
  • Ensure all technical approvals/agreements for section 38, 278, 104 and 185 agreements are secured.
  • Undertake regular site visits and provide on-site support for construction related activities.

Health and Safety/CDM

  • Understand and promote Health and Safety.
  • Collate Pre-Construction Information Packs and Information for Health And Safety Plans.
  • Understand the Designers responsibilities under the latest CDM regulations.
  • Undertake the Principal Designer Role
  • Must undertake continuous professional development.
